Tokusatsu fans unite! For authentic Bioman gear, I swear by Yahoo Japan Auctions via proxy services like Buyee. Scored a mint-condition Pink Five helmet last year after stalking listings for months. Social media groups dedicated to '80s Sentai are goldmines too—members often trade or sell duplicates. Don’t overlook conventions either; even smaller anime cons sometimes have dealers with hidden Tokusatsu sections. The thrill of hunting down these relics is half the fun!
Bandai’s official store occasionally restocks classic Bioman items, but they sell out fast. I missed the last batch of DX Bio Robo toys and still kick myself. For budget options, Suruga-ya’s secondhand site has affordable pins and vinyl figures, though condition varies. Local hobby shops might surprise you—mine had a dusty box of '80s Bioman candy toys behind the counter. Always ask!
Bioman merchandise is such a nostalgic gem! For vintage collectors, eBay and Mercari Japan are treasure troves—I’ve snagged rare action figures there, though shipping can be pricey. Specialty stores like Mandarake in Akihabara also stock retro Tokusatsu goods, but their online shop requires patience navigating Japanese listings. For newer items, check Bandai’s Tamashii Nations line; they occasionally drop reissues.
If you’re into DIY, Etsy has fan-made patches and posters that capture the show’s retro vibe. Just saw a handmade ‘Bio Robo’ keychain last week that made me grin like I was 10 again.
My obsession led me down weird paths: once bought a Bioman poster from a Thai night market stall! For reliable options, HLJ (HobbyLink Japan) gets occasional stock, and their packaging is bulletproof. Instagram accounts like @tokutoyz post rare finds daily—follow them for drops. Also, check Combini stores in Japan during anniversaries; they sometimes carry collab merch like soda bottles with character designs.
Finding Bioman merch feels like a quest sometimes. Online, AmiAmi’s pre-owned section is worth bookmarking—they grade items honestly. For clothing, Redbubble has decent fan art tees if you want subtle nods to the show. Physical stores? Try Nakano Broadway in Tokyo; its labyrinth of shops hides gems. Pro tip: Learn katakana to search better—typing 'バイオマン' yields more results than 'Bioman' on Japanese sites.
